General Definition:
The Bartender duties include mixing and serving alcoholic and non-alcoholic beverages and food items to patrons in a friendly, courteous and professional manner.
Essential Job Functions: The Bartender will be responsible for preparing and serving drinks to customers accurately and efficiently, while maintaining positive and friendly guest interactions The purpose of this position it to interact with the suite guests and ensure they have a great experience in there suite. The Bartender is able to mix and match ingredients to create classic and innovative drinks in accordance with customers' needs and expectations Responsibilities Interact with customers in a friendly and helpful manner; take and serve orders for drinks and snacks Mix drinks, cocktails, and other bar beverages, including non-alcoholic beverages, as ordered and in compliance with hotel standard drink recipes Check identification of the guest to make sure they meet age requirements for purchase of alcohol products Determine when a customer has had too much alcohol and, if required, refusing any further serving in a polite way Provide guidance to guests on horse racing. Arrange bottles and glasses to make attractive displays Keep the bar counter and work area neat and clean at all times; wash glassware and utensils after each use; keep working area clean by sweeping, vacuuming, dusting, cleaning of glass doors, and windows, etc. Plan and present bar menu; demonstrate a thorough knowledge of good and beverage products, menus, and promotions Handle and move objects, such as glass and bottles, using hands and arms; perform other physical activities such as lifting and stooping Maintain liquor inventory and consumption; prepare inventory as needed to replenish supplies; ensure the assigned bar area is fully equipped with tools and products needed for mixing beverages and serving guests Handle an assigned house bank and follow all cash handling procedures as per hotel standard; collect payment for drinks service and balance all receipts Stay focused and nurture an excellent guest experience Comply with all food and beverage regulations Perform other duties as and when assigned.
